Black Girls in Tech was founded with the purpose of becoming a community for black women. It was created to be a safe space where black women can come together, encourage / motivate one another and help each other on our journey. Our aim to to make technology more accessible to black women and to increase the representation of black women in technology.
We aim to foster a community of black women who are in technology at any level and those who want to get into the tech space. We offer a network , a sense of community , sisterhood and mentorship.
We aim to provide resources for those in tech and those who want to get into tech in the form of existing resources and our own curated educational resources/bootcamps.
We aim to give opportunities to our members such as scholarships , bootcamps and also market jobs on our website.
